AAI initiates solar project bidding for Chennai Airport

The Airports Authority of India (AAI) has set its sights on harnessing solar power to bolster sustainability efforts at Chennai Airport. In an initiative geared towards enhancing green energy utilisation, AAI has invited bids for the development of a solar project at the Chennai airport premises. This move underscores AAI's commitment to adopting renewable energy solutions and reducing carbon footprints in aviation infrastructure.

The project, which is slated to be installed on a 'build, own, operate' basis, holds significant promise in augmenting the airport's energy capacity while simultaneously mitigating environmental impact. By leveraging solar power, Chennai Airport aims to substantially decrease its dependency on conventional energy sources, thus paving the way for a greener, more sustainable future.

The solicitation of bids for the solar project signifies a pivotal step in AAI's strategic roadmap towards embracing clean energy alternatives. Through this endeavor, AAI seeks to capitalize on the abundant solar potential in the region, harnessing sunlight to generate electricity and power the airport's operations efficiently.

The envisioned solar project is poised to be a substantial addition to Chennai Airport's energy portfolio, enhancing its resilience and reducing operating costs over the long term. Furthermore, by tapping into solar energy, the airport can contribute significantly to India's renewable energy targets while aligning with global sustainability goals.

The bidding process invites proposals from qualified developers to design, install, and maintain the solar infrastructure at Chennai Airport. With a focus on quality, reliability, and cost-effectiveness, AAI aims to select a partner capable of delivering a robust solar solution that meets the airport's energy requirements and adheres to stringent performance standards.

Saarstahl Rail to Supply Tracks for Bengaluru Suburban Rail Project

Rail Infrastructure Development Company Karnataka Limited (K-RIDE) has identified Saarstahl Rail as the lowest bidder for the track supply contract in the Bangalore Suburban Railway Project.
